Harris's Closing Message
- Kamala Harris's closing message focuses on the dangers of a second Trump presidency, emphasizing his instability.
- She uses testimonials from former Trump officials and highlights specific instances of his concerning behavior.
Kelly's Revelations
- General John Kelly, Trump's former chief of staff, revealed alarming anecdotes about Trump's behavior.
- Kelly claims Trump praised Hitler and desired generals loyal to him, not the Constitution.
Undecided Voters
- Undecided voters, many of whom are Republican-leaning, are a key target for both campaigns.
- These voters, disturbed by January 6th and Dobbs, could potentially break for Harris.
